At a Glance
- Tasks: Develop and enhance backend and mobile/web apps with innovative features.
- Company: Join Emma, a dynamic app revolutionising personal finance management.
- Benefits: Enjoy competitive salary, flexible work options, and growth opportunities.
- Why this job: Be part of a high-performance team making a real impact in financial lives.
- Qualifications: 5+ years of full-stack engineering experience and a passion for coding.
- Other info: Fast-paced environment with a focus on innovation and teamwork.
The predicted salary is between 28800 - 48000 £ per year.
About the Company
Emma is the app to manage all things money. Our mission is to empower millions of people to live a better and more fulfilling financial life. Emma was founded by engineers focused on coding, product and data, which form the three pillars of our tech culture and our aim to fix personal finance once for all. We have raised more than $8m to date to build the one-stop shop for all your financial life. Our investors include Connect Ventures, Kima Ventures, Aglaé Ventures, and several angel investors.
At Emma, we are a high-performance team and we run the company like a professional sports team. We expect each team member to move fast, own their work, and hold each other to a high standard. If you’re not driven to own your work, execute swiftly, and innovate constantly, this isn’t the right place for you.
Responsibilities
About the role: You will focus both on our backend and mobile/web apps! We have an intense roadmap ahead, which includes a plethora of new features and integrations, which you will be part of.
Our Tech Stack:
- Languages: TypeScript, Javascript
- Libraries and frameworks: gRPC, Redux, React Native, React, Next.js
- Datastores: Vitess, MySQL, CockroachDB, BigQuery, Redis
- Infrastructure: Google Cloud Platform, Kubernetes, Docker, PubSub, Terraform
- Monitoring: Grafana, Prometheus, Sentry, Metabase
About You
- You are a full-stack engineer with at least 5 years’ experience.
- You are fast and love to deliver incredible code.
- You can reduce complex problems to simple solutions.
- You want to be part of an amazing team.
- You are excited by what we’re building at Emma.
Our Process
- Take-home coding test
- Phone call with our internal recruiter
- 2nd call with CTO
- Onsite interview with CEO & CTO
Our Benefits
Senior Full Stack Engineer in England employer: Emma - we are hiring!
Contact Detail:
Emma - we are hiring!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Senior Full Stack Engineer in England
✨Tip Number 1
Get to know Emma and its mission inside out! When you understand what drives us, you can tailor your conversations to show how your skills align with our goals. This will make you stand out during interviews.
✨Tip Number 2
Prepare for the coding test like it’s a big game day! Brush up on TypeScript and JavaScript, and practice solving problems quickly. We love engineers who can deliver incredible code under pressure.
✨Tip Number 3
During your calls with our recruiter and CTO, don’t just answer questions—ask them too! Show your curiosity about our tech stack and future projects. It’ll demonstrate your enthusiasm and help you connect with us.
✨Tip Number 4
Finally, ap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, it shows you’re serious about joining our high-performance team at Emma.
We think you need these skills to ace Senior Full Stack Engineer in England
Some tips for your application 🫡
Show Your Passion: When writing your application, let your enthusiasm for Emma and our mission shine through. We want to see that you're not just looking for a job, but that you're genuinely excited about helping people manage their finances better.
Tailor Your CV: Make sure your CV highlights relevant experience with our tech stack, especially TypeScript and React. We love seeing how your skills align with what we do, so don’t be shy about showcasing your best projects!
Be Clear and Concise: Keep your application straightforward and to the point. We appreciate clarity, so avoid jargon and focus on what makes you a great fit for the role. Remember, we’re looking for someone who can reduce complex problems to simple solutions!
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ures it gets into the right hands quickly. Plus, it shows you’re proactive and keen to join our team!
How to prepare for a job interview at Emma - we are hiring!
✨Know Your Tech Stack
Familiarise yourself with the technologies mentioned in the job description, like TypeScript, React, and Google Cloud Platform. Be ready to discuss your experience with these tools and how you've used them in past projects.
✨Showcase Your Problem-Solving Skills
Prepare to demonstrate how you approach complex problems. Think of specific examples where you've simplified a challenging issue into an effective solution. This will resonate well with their focus on innovation and efficiency.
✨Emphasise Team Collaboration
Since Emma values a high-performance team culture, be sure to highlight your experiences working in teams. Share stories that showcase your ability to own your work while also supporting your teammates to achieve common goals.
✨Prepare for Technical Challenges
Expect a take-home coding test and technical interviews. Brush up on your coding skills and practice common algorithms or frameworks relevant to the role. Being well-prepared will help you feel confident and ready to impress.